CodeNation : AI 앱 스토리

  • 홈
  • AI App Story
  • Code Archive
  • YouTube

2014/09/17 1

strategy pattern(스트래티지 패턴)

strategy pattern(스트래티지 패턴) 알고리즘군을 정의하고 각각을 캡슐화하여 교환하여 사용할수 있도록 만들어 기존 클래스와는 독립적으로 알고리즘 변경이 가능하다. 예제 코드>1. Car 클래스속성 : speed - double(차량의 속도를 저장할 변수), gear - int(기어값을 저장할 변수)기능 : onAccel(), onBreak(), changeGear()onAccel() : 차량 속도를 올리는 메서드onBreak() : 차량 속도를 줄이는 메서드changeGear() : 기어 변경 메서드 - Car.javapackage com.strategy.test; public class Car {private static final int MAX_SPEED = 250;private doubl..

Code Archive/ETC 2014.09.17
이전
1
다음
더보기
프로필사진

CodeNation : AI 앱 스토리

YouTube 'AI 앱 스토리' 강의 자료실 & Code Archive

  • 분류 전체보기 (90)
    • AI App Story (2)
      • Antigravity (2)
      • Gemini & Caulde & Copilot C.. (0)
      • MCP (0)
    • Code Archive (87)
      • C언어 (17)
      • C++ (13)
      • JAVA (24)
      • Unity3D (6)
      • Android (4)
      • ETC (3)
      • cocos2d-x (3)
      • php (11)
      • C# (3)
      • myBatis (3)

Tag

C언어, java, unity3D, C++,

최근글과 인기글

  • 최근글
  • 인기글

최근댓글

공지사항

페이스북 트위터 플러그인

  • Facebook
  • Twitter

Archives

Calendar

«   2014/09   »
일 월 화 수 목 금 토
1 2 3 4 5 6
7 8 9 10 11 12 13
14 15 16 17 18 19 20
21 22 23 24 25 26 27
28 29 30

방문자수Total

  • Today :
  • Yesterday :

Copyright © AXZ Corp. All rights reserved.

티스토리툴바